Ok so I see a lot of people posting that they are having their game start lagging when they start running OBS... I don't have a problem with in game lag... My issue is with the recording the game. When I start recording my game runs the same, no lag no random freezes but when I go back and look at the video I recorded I see a lot of the character freezing or standing in place when I was moving. The video will show my character standing in place then suddenly jump ahead then standing in place and then jumping instead of the straight run I did. Also when fighting in game it runs smoothly but when you look at the video it is all choppy and you can hear the character fighting but again it is just standing there looking like nothing is happening then suddenly the video will go to mid fight and it is all jumpy there too. How do I fix this?
